Symbolische Sprachverarbeitung bezieht sich auf die Methode der Verarbeitung natürlicher Sprache durch den Einsatz von Regeln und Symbolen, die von menschlicher Sprache abgeleitet sind. Im Gegensatz zu statistischen Methoden basiert sie auf festen grammatikalischen Strukturen und semantischen Interpretationen, um Bedeutungen aus Texten abzuleiten. Diese Technik wurde häufig in der Anfangszeit der Künstlichen Intelligenz eingesetzt und spielt immer noch eine Rolle in Bereichen, die präzise Regelwerke und logische Schlussfolgerungen erfordern.
Symbolische Sprachverarbeitung ist der Bereich der Informatik, der sich mit der Verarbeitung und Analyse natürlicher Sprache durch Computer beschäftigt. Es verbindet Techniken der Linguistik mit Algorithmen der Informatik, um sprachliche Daten effizient zu verstehen und zu manipulieren.
Wofür wird Symbolische Sprachverarbeitung verwendet?
Symbolische Sprachverarbeitung wird in vielen Bereichen eingesetzt, um Textdaten zu analysieren und zu verstehen. Einige Anwendungen umfassen:
Spracherkennung: Identifikation und Interpretation gesprochener Worte.
Textzusammenfassung: Automatisierung der Komprimierung von Inhalten in eine kürzere Form.
Sentimentanalyse: Erkennung der emotionalen Tendenz eines Textes.
Symbolische Sprachverarbeitung ist die Anwendung mathematischer und linguistischer Techniken, um die Struktur und Bedeutung von Sprache durch Maschinen zu verstehen und zu manipulieren.
Ein einfaches Beispiel für symbolische Sprachverarbeitung ist der Einsatz von Suchalgorithmen, um relevante Informationen aus textlichen Daten zu extrahieren. Stelle Dir ein Programm vor, das automatisch bestimmte Keywords in einem Artikel identifiziert und die wichtigsten Absätze zusammenstellt.
Künstliche Intelligenz und maschinelles Lernen sind eng mit der symbolischen Sprachverarbeitung verbunden, da sie helfen, die Leistungsfähigkeit von Algorithmen bei der Analyse natürlicher Sprache zu verbessern.
Grundlagen der symbolischen Sprachverarbeitung
Die Grundlagen der symbolischen Sprachverarbeitung konzentrieren sich auf die Verwendung von Computern zur Analyse und Verarbeitung natürlicher Sprache. Integration von Algorithmen und linguistischen Theorien, um Text zu verstehen, sind wesentliche Bestandteile dieser Disziplin. Dabei ist es wichtig, sowohl syntaktische als auch semantische Informationen zu berücksichtigen.
Wichtige Konzepte und Komponenten
Bei der symbolischen Sprachverarbeitung kommen mehrere zentrale Konzepte und Komponenten zum Einsatz:
Lexikon: Eine Sammlung von Wörtern und ihren Bedeutungen.
Grammatik: Regeln, die bestimmen, wie Wörter zu sinnvollen Sätzen kombiniert werden.
Parser: Ein Programm, das die Syntax eines Satzes analysiert.
Semantik: Interpretation der Bedeutung von Wörtern und Sätzen.
Ein Parser ist ein Tool, das verwendet wird, um die grammatikalische Struktur eines Satzes zu analysieren und zu bestimmen, ob dieser Satz der zugrunde liegenden Grammatik entspricht.
Angenommen, du programmierst einen einfachen Parser in Python, um grundlegende Sätze zu analysieren:
Ein tiefes Verständnis der semantischen Verarbeitung erfordert die Analyse von Bedeutungsstrukturen weit über die Syntax hinaus. Ein Beispiel ist die Entitätserkennung, bei der der Computer nicht nur erkennt, dass 'Apfel' ein Objekt ist, sondern möglicherweise auch, dass es sich auf die Marke Apple bezieht. Hierfür werden oft maschinelle Lernmodelle eingesetzt, die trainiert wurden, um kontextuelle Informationen zu verarbeiten und zu verstehen.
Zum besseren Verständnis von Symbol- und Sprachstrukturen kann es hilfreich sein, sich mit den Grundlagen der formalen Logik und Linguistik auseinanderzusetzen.
Techniken der symbolischen Sprachverarbeitung
In der symbolischen Sprachverarbeitung kommen verschiedene Techniken zum Einsatz, die es ermöglichen, Sprache auf detaillierte und strukturierte Weise zu analysieren. Diese Techniken sind entscheidend, um Computern das Verständnis und die Verarbeitung von natürlicher Sprache zu ermöglichen.
Kategorisierung von Techniken
Symbolische Sprachverarbeitungstechniken lassen sich in mehrere Kategorien unterteilen:
Morphologische Analyse: Untersucht die Struktur von Wörtern und deren Bestandteile wie Wurzeln und Affixe.
Syntaktische Analyse (Parsing): Erkennt und analysiert Satzstrukturen anhand grammatischer Regeln.
Semantische Verarbeitung: Versteht und interpretiert die Bedeutung von Sätzen und ihren Bestandteilen.
Diskursanalyse: Schaut auf die sprachlichen Strukturen jenseits einzelner Sätze, wie z.B. anaphorische Bezüge.
Die semantische Verarbeitung ist ein kritischer Prozess in der symbolischen Sprachverarbeitung, durch den die Bedeutung von Sprache erfasst und verstanden wird.
Ein Beispiel für syntaktische Analyse kann in einem einfachen Python-Algorithmus gezeigt werden. Untenstehend wird ein Parser demonstriert, der einfache Satzstrukturen analysiert:
In der symbolischen Sprachverarbeitung werden häufig Techniken der formalen Grammatiktheorie herangezogen. Diese Theorien helfen dabei, Regeln für die Sprachstruktur zu formulieren, die dann durch Computerprogramme analysiert und angewendet werden können. Eine spannende Entwicklung auf diesem Gebiet ist der Einsatz von generativen grammatischen Modellen, die syntaktische Muster erlernen können, um Sprachinhalte automatisiert zu generieren und zu modifizieren.
Der Einsatz von Thesauren kann die semantische Verarbeitung verbessern, indem er Synonyme und verwandte Begriffe in Textanalysen einführt.
Anwendungen der symbolischen Sprachverarbeitung
Die symbolische Sprachverarbeitung wird in einer Vielzahl von Anwendungen verwendet, um Text und Sprache zu analysieren, zu verstehen und zu generieren. Künstliche Intelligenz und maschinelles Lernen sind eng verknüpft mit der symbolischen Sprachverarbeitung und treiben viele dieser Anwendungen voran.
Symbolische Sprachverarbeitung einfach erklärt
Auf einfache Weise gesagt, behandelt die symbolische Sprachverarbeitung die Art und Weise, wie Computer natürliche Sprache verarbeiten und verstehen. Diese Technologie ermöglicht es, dass Maschinen menschliche Sprache analysieren können, um Inhalte zu extrahieren und nützliche Aufgaben zu erfüllen. Beispiele hierfür sind:
Virtuelle Assistenten: Diese verwenden symbolische Sprachverarbeitung, um auf Sprachbefehle zu reagieren.
Automatisierte Kundenservice-Systeme: Systeme, die Beschwerden oder Fragen anhand der analysierten Sprache beantworten können.
Textmining: Automatisierte Analyse großer Textmengen, um Muster und Beziehungen zu erkennen.
Ein typisches Beispiel für den Nutzen der symbolischen Sprachverarbeitung ist die Spracherkennung. Technologien wie Siri oder Google Assistant verwenden Sprachverarbeitung, um Sprachbefehle zu analysieren und darauf zu reagieren:
Die symbolische Sprachverarbeitung ist ein Teilgebiet der Informatik, das sich mit der Analyse, der Interpretation und der Generierung von natürlicher Sprache durch Computer beschäftigt.
Ein tieferes Verständnis der linguistischen Grundlagen kann helfen, die symbolische Sprachverarbeitung besser zu begreifen.
Sprachverarbeitung Informatik und ihre Bedeutung
Die Bedeutung der Sprachverarbeitung in der Informatik wächst stetig, da die Notwendigkeit besteht, riesige Mengen an Textdaten zu analysieren und zu verstehen. Durch technologische Fortschritte hat die symbolische Sprachverarbeitung erheblich dazu beigetragen, wie Informationen verarbeitet werden.Einige Schlüsselaspekte sind:
Verbesserte Datenanalysefähigkeiten ermöglichen eine bessere Entscheidungsfindung.
Sprachverarbeitung trägt zu einer höheren Benutzerfreundlichkeit von Software bei.
Vielfältige Anwendungen in Bereichen wie Marketing, Gesundheit und Bildung.
Die Rolle der korpusbasierten Analysen in der symbolischen Sprachverarbeitung ist von zentraler Bedeutung. Diese Analysen erlauben es, Sprachmuster in großen Textsammlungen zu untersuchen, was helfen kann, semantische Bedeutungen und grammatikalische Strukturen besser zu verstehen. Fortschritte in diesem Bereich verbessern die Fähigkeit von Maschinen, natürliche Sprache natürlicher zu nutzen.
Fortschritte in der symbolischen Sprachverarbeitung
In den letzten Jahren hat es bemerkenswerte Fortschritte in den Algorithmen und Anwendungsmöglichkeiten der symbolischen Sprachverarbeitung gegeben. Diese Fortschritte gehen über die grundlegende Sprachverarbeitung hinaus und erfassen komplexere Sprachmuster und -strukturen.Fortschritte wie:
Deep Learning: Deep Learning-Modelle ermöglichen es, tiefere semantische Zusammenhänge zu verstehen.
Transformator-Modelle: Diese revolutionieren, wie natürliche Sprache verarbeitet wird, indem sie Muster in großen Datenmengen erkennen.
Multimodale Verarbeitung: Diese Technologien kombinieren Textdaten mit anderen Datenformen, um kontextreiche Informationen zu erzeugen.
Beispielsweise hat das OpenAI-Modell GPT erhebliche Fortschritte in der Textgenerierung gemacht und ist in der Lage, natürlich klingende Textabsätze zu schreiben.
Herausforderungen bei der symbolischen Sprachverarbeitung
Trotz der vielen Erfolge gibt es in der symbolischen Sprachverarbeitung immer noch Herausforderungen, die überwunden werden müssen. Einige dieser Herausforderungen sind:
Ambiguität: Ein Wort kann mehrere Bedeutungen haben, was die Genauigkeit beeinträchtigen kann.
Kulturelle Nuancen: Unterschiede in Kultur und Sprache machen es schwierig, eine universelle Verarbeitungslösung zu entwickeln.
Skalierbarkeit: Die Verarbeitung großer Datenmengen erfordert erhebliche rechnerische Ressourcen.
Die Verwendung von Feedback-Loops kann dazu beitragen, die Genauigkeit symbolischer Sprachverarbeitungsmodelle zu verbessern.
Symbolische Sprachverarbeitung - Das Wichtigste
Symbolische Sprachverarbeitung: Ein Bereich der Informatik, der sich mit der Verarbeitung natürlicher Sprache durch Computer beschäftigt, durch Kombination von linguistischen Methoden und Informatikalghorithmen.
Techniken der symbolischen Sprachverarbeitung: Morphologische und syntaktische Analyse, semantische Verarbeitung, Diskursanalyse.
Grundlagen der symbolischen Sprachverarbeitung: Nutzung von Computern zur linguistischen Analyse, Berücksichtigung von syntaktischen und semantischen Aspekten.
Sprachverarbeitung in der Informatik: Zentral für die Analyse und das Verständnis großer Textmengen, verbessert Benutzerfreundlichkeit von Anwendungen.
Herausforderungen: Ambiguität in der Sprache, kulturelle Unterschiede und die Notwendigkeit großer Rechenkapazitäten.
Lerne schneller mit den 12 Karteikarten zu Symbolische Sprachverarbeitung
Melde dich kostenlos an, um Zugriff auf all unsere Karteikarten zu erhalten.
Häufig gestellte Fragen zum Thema Symbolische Sprachverarbeitung
Wie funktioniert symbolische Sprachverarbeitung im Vergleich zu neuronalen Netzwerken?
Symbolische Sprachverarbeitung basiert auf regelbasierten Ansätzen, die explizite Grammatikregeln und Wissensrepräsentationen verwenden, um Sprache zu verstehen. Im Gegensatz dazu nutzen neuronale Netzwerke statistische Modelle und große Datenmengen, um Muster zu erkennen und Sprache zu generieren, ohne explizite Regeln zu benötigen.
Was sind die wichtigsten Anwendungsbereiche der symbolischen Sprachverarbeitung?
Die wichtigsten Anwendungsbereiche der symbolischen Sprachverarbeitung sind maschinelle Übersetzung, Frage-Antwort-Systeme, Textanalyse, Sprachsynthese und Informationsextraktion. Diese Anwendungen nutzen symbolische Algorithmen zur Verarbeitung und Analyse natürlicher Sprache, um menschenähnliches Verständnis und Kommunikation durch Computer zu ermöglichen.
Welche Vorteile bietet die symbolische Sprachverarbeitung gegenüber statistischen Methoden?
Symbolische Sprachverarbeitung bietet den Vorteil, dass sie auf explizitem linguistischen Wissen basiert, was zu präziseren und interpretierbaren Ergebnissen führt. Sie ermöglicht das Verständnis komplexer Sprachstrukturen und selten vorkommender Phänomene besser als statistische Methoden, die auf großen Datenmengen angewiesen sind.
Welche Herausforderungen gibt es bei der Implementierung symbolischer Sprachverarbeitungssysteme?
Zu den Herausforderungen zählen die Ambiguität natürlicher Sprache, die Komplexität grammatischer Regeln, der Bedarf an umfangreichen Wissensdatenbanken und die effiziente Verarbeitung großer Datenmengen. Zudem erfordert es fein abgestimmte Algorithmen, um Kontextverstehen und Bedeutungsnuancen korrekt zu erfassen und zu verarbeiten.
Wie wird Wissen in symbolischen Sprachverarbeitungssystemen repräsentiert?
Wissen in symbolischen Sprachverarbeitungssystemen wird durch formale Regeln und Strukturen wie Grammatikregeln, Ontologien und logische Aussagen repräsentiert. Diese Darstellungen organisieren und verarbeiten Informationen in symbolischen Formaten, die semantische und syntaktische Aspekte der Sprache modellieren.
Wie stellen wir sicher, dass unser Content korrekt und vertrauenswürdig ist?
Bei StudySmarter haben wir eine Lernplattform geschaffen, die Millionen von Studierende unterstützt. Lerne die Menschen kennen, die hart daran arbeiten, Fakten basierten Content zu liefern und sicherzustellen, dass er überprüft wird.
Content-Erstellungsprozess:
Lily Hulatt
Digital Content Specialist
Lily Hulatt ist Digital Content Specialist mit über drei Jahren Erfahrung in Content-Strategie und Curriculum-Design. Sie hat 2022 ihren Doktortitel in Englischer Literatur an der Durham University erhalten, dort auch im Fachbereich Englische Studien unterrichtet und an verschiedenen Veröffentlichungen mitgewirkt. Lily ist Expertin für Englische Literatur, Englische Sprache, Geschichte und Philosophie.
Gabriel Freitas ist AI Engineer mit solider Erfahrung in Softwareentwicklung, maschinellen Lernalgorithmen und generativer KI, einschließlich Anwendungen großer Sprachmodelle (LLMs). Er hat Elektrotechnik an der Universität von São Paulo studiert und macht aktuell seinen MSc in Computertechnik an der Universität von Campinas mit Schwerpunkt auf maschinellem Lernen. Gabriel hat einen starken Hintergrund in Software-Engineering und hat an Projekten zu Computer Vision, Embedded AI und LLM-Anwendungen gearbeitet.